Class B CDL Driver

Triumvirate Environmental, one of North America's largest environmental services firms, is seeking a Class B CDL Driver to join our Somerville team. The role involves operating both a standard and vacuum truck to load and transport hazardous waste from various client locations.

We are in search of a highly motivated, detail-oriented, and customer service-focused individual. Responsibilities will include handling local runs or offloads across various locations in the greater Boston area. In addition, this individual will work in collaboration with the Field Services team onsite to fulfill assigned projects.

Essential responsibilities:
  • Operate standard and vacuum trucks to load and transport hazardous waste from client sites, with a focus on local route driving.
  • Ensure accurate pick-up and delivery of hazardous and non-hazardous waste, prioritizing exceptional customer service.
  • Show determination/eagerness to learn and retain a basic knowledge of daily work practices.
  • Develop an understanding of DOT, EPA & OSHA regulations and TEIs Health and Safety Practices.
  • Complete all necessary paperwork accurately and efficiently.
  • Routinely perform pre- and post-trip inspections.
Required qualifications:
  • High School Diploma or equivalent required.
  • Minimum of Class B Commercial Driver's License (CDL) in good standing.
  • 6+ months Tanker driving experience.
  • Hazmat and Tanker Endorsements.
  • Manual driving experience.
  • Basic knowledge of, or interest in, hazardous waste field.
  • Self-motivated person with the desire to learn.
  • Successful completion of OSHA/ DOT physical examination which includes drug and alcohol screening.
Preferred Skills:
  • Completion of 40 Hour OSHA, CPR and First Aid Training.
